    Probably deserves its own thread. Great analysis by John Krolik from Cavs the Blog from Sept. 09, breaking down Kevin Martin's game:

    http://www.slamonline.com/online/nba/slamonline-top-50/2009/09/top-50-kevin-martin-no-41/

    Highlight:
    But it’s Martin’s True Shooting, the best indicator of scoring efficiency available, that’s really incredible- his 60% TS last season is almost unprecedented for someone who scores as much as he does. Even more amazingly, that mark was Martin’s lowest TS since his rookie season, and a big step down from his last two seasons, when he recorded marks of 61.4% and 61.8%. Overall, Martin has the 2nd-highest career TS among all active players, trailing only Brent Barry.

    To be completely clear: 60% TS for a #1 option is INSANE. LeBron’s never cracked 60%. Neither has Kobe, whose career high is 58% and average is 56%. Wade’s never done it. The last season MJ did it was the 1990-91 campaign.
